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Secunda to Qonce is to taxi and bus which costs R 1 600 - R 2 400 and takes 17h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Secunda to Qonce is to taxi and fly and bus which takes 5h 23m and costs R 2 600 - R 5 500.
The distance between Secunda and Qonce is 964 km. The road distance is 1018.1 km.
The best way to get from Secunda to Qonce without a car is to taxi and bus which takes 17h 11m and costs R 1 600 - R 2 400.
It takes approximately 5h 23m to get from Secunda to Qonce,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Secunda to Qonce is 1018 km. It takes approximately 12h 3m to drive from Secunda to Qonce.
